First we went to the National Gallery of Scotland and looked at art from the different artistic movements. After the gallery we walked to Calton Hill and there were some amazing views, so that obviously led to photo ops.. At Calton Hill we saw what was known as the Scottish National Monument, a memorial for fallen Scottish soldiers from the Napoleonic Wars, which started construction in 1826. However, due to a poor economy there were money problems and the monument was left unfinished in 1829. The monument became known as Scotland's Disgrace to symbolize the failure of its construction. From the top of the hill we could see the sea and that view was incredible. Along the way, we took in the culture and architecture of Edinburgh, which is varied and styled after ancient Athens.
